Namaste, At 2.7 years of age, a child may sometimes have low appetite or slow weight gain, especially if they are picky with food. It is important to focus on regular nutrition and healthy eating habits rather than giving strong herbal powders without proper guidance. Simple measures that may help: Offer small, frequent meals instead of forcing large meals. Include nutritious foods like mashed banana, khichdi, dal, eggs (if suitable), fruits, milk, and homemade porridge. Avoid too many snacks, sweets, or packaged foods, as they can reduce appetite for proper meals. Encourage active play and regular routine, which can help improve hunger. Try to make food colorful and attractive so the child becomes more interested in eating. Since her weight is quite low for her age, it would also be good to consult a pediatrician to check growth, nutrition, and rule out any deficiency.
